#e7d2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7d2ec is composed of 90.6% red, 82.4%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.1% cyan, 11%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 288.5 degrees, a saturation of 40.6% and a lightness of 87.5%. #e7d2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cfa5d9.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

● #e7d2ec color description : Light grayish magenta.
#e7d2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7d2ec has RGB values of R:231, G:210,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15192812.
